The New Year brings two new appointments to the supervisory board of Wall AG. Dieter Keppler, managing director of JCDecaux Germany and Dr. Oleg de Lousanoff, partner, lawyer and notary at corporate law firm Hengeler Mueller, enter the supervisory board as new members. They succeed Professor Jobst Plog and Dieter Johannsen-Roth who both leave the board. The supervisory board of Wall AG now consist of chairman Hans Wall, vice-chairman Jean- François Decaux, Roland von zur Muehlen, Dieter Keppler and Dr. de Lousanoff.
Dr. Oleg de Lousanoff, who was born in 1952 in Frankfurt (Main), is since 1984 partner at the law firm Hengeler Mueller. After studying law and economics in Freiburg and Berkley, Dr. de Lousanoff taught at the University of Freiburg. In 1981 he successfully passed the Second State Exam and embarked on a career as a lawyer at Hengeler Mueller. Dr. de Lousanoff is a distinguished specialist in company law, takeovers and mergers.
Dieter Keppler has been managing director of JCDecaux Germany GmbH since 1987. Before starting his career in the advertising department of the Hamburg based publishing house "Jahreszeitenverlag", he took vocational training in advertising and graduated in business administration. After five years with LINTAS advertising agency, Dieter Keppler in 1978 founded Concept-Media which he led as managing partner until 1987.
"We are glad to welcome Mr. Keppler and Dr. de Lousanoff as new members of our supervisory board. At the same time we would like to express our thanks to Professor Plog and Mr. Johannsen-Roth for their dedicated work on the board", Daniel Wall, Chief Executive Officer of Wall AG, points out. "With Mr. Keppler as a member, we will be able to achieve optimum synergy with our partner JCDecaux. Furthermore, with Dr. de Lousanoff we have won an eminent legal expert to help us set the course for the successful future collaboration of our companies."
